What do your eyes have to do with neck pain?
Today I had a patient with stubborn neck pain when she turned her head to the left. I did some soft tissue work which helped a little, but something still was not adding up. So I checked her eyes. When she tried to look left her gaze stopped short and she could not see as far on that side as she could on the right.
Most people do not realize this, but the eyes are the first part of the body to turn. The eyes lead the movement and the neck follows. If the eyes cannot move fully the neck will not move fully either. The two systems are wired together.
